6.2 BGP (Border Gateway Protocol). Часть 2. Соседские отношения. Начало

2024 ж. 15 Мам.
421 Рет қаралды

Продолжаем цикл видео про протокол BGP. Соседские отношения - что это, зачем нужны, как устанавливаются?
Внимание!!! В видео закралась ошибка! Примерно на 18:49. Правильно так - если параметры не понравятся одному из роутеров, то он отправит сообщение BGP Notification с описанием ошибки и закроет TCP сессию сообщением FIN. Спасибо пользователю @Alex-eh1be за бдительность.
00:00 - Что будет в этом видео?
00:51 - Краткое содержание прошлых видео цикла. Автономные системы
02:57 - Что и как происходит в процессе установления соседских отношений
04:59 - BGP работает через TCP. Как устанавливается TCP сессия
06:29 - У соседей BGP должен быть маршрут до соседа
07:48 - Команда neighbor. iBGP или eBGP
09:38 - Демонстрация. Запуск BGP на R1 без маршрута до соседа, а потом с маршрутом по умолчанию
13:40 - TCP сессия должна установиться правильно. Не должно быть мешающих ACL и на соседе должен быть запущен BGP
15:20 - BGP пакет OPEN.
16:20 - Демонстрация. Запуск BGP на R2. Соседство. Как установка соседства выглядит в Wireshark
20:33 - Краткие итоги. Что было в этом видео
Плейлист: 6. Протокол BGP ССNP/CCIE
• 6. Протокол BGP ССNP/CCIE

Пікірлер
  • 18:49 Специально проверил этот момент, если параметры не согласуются, соединение не сбрасывается с флагом RST. Отправляется NOTIFICATION Message с описанием ошибки, TCP сессия закрывается стандартно через FIN.

    @Alex-eh1be@Alex-eh1be17 күн бұрын
    • Блин, точно. Notification отправляется. В самом конце накосячил. 😢 Сейчас подумаю. Может переделаю и перезалью видео.

      @Nikolay_Bulganin@Nikolay_Bulganin17 күн бұрын
    • @@Nikolay_Bulganin Кстати, в процессе эксперимента обнаружил одну удивительную вещь. Хеш пароля передается в TCP SYN как опция, и если они не совпадают, сессия не установится. Причем RST не будет, сосед просто не станет отвечать. Не зная, по трафику и не поймешь в чем дело.

      @Alex-eh1be@Alex-eh1be17 күн бұрын
    • Ну да. С таким сталкивался. Есть реализации, где хэш пароля передаётся в сообщение OPEN в поле Marker, а есть где вот так. Про косяк с завершением сессии при несовпадении параметров - напишу в описании к видео. Спасибо за замечание.

      @Nikolay_Bulganin@Nikolay_Bulganin16 күн бұрын
  • автор, а ты расскажешь про ширину канала провайдера? Как настраивается? Вот эти тонкости, я так и не успел этот освоить в молодые годы(

    @unicoxr5tj417@unicoxr5tj41717 күн бұрын
    • Извини, вообще не понял о чём вопрос. Про QoS, про шейпинг? Или про что-то ещё? Не понятно.

      @Nikolay_Bulganin@Nikolay_Bulganin16 күн бұрын
    • @@Nikolay_Bulganin я сам не знаю, мои старшие админы говорили, что расширяли канал до Москвы у инет-провайдера. Как? Что? Понмания вопроса нет. Пропускной способностью называют максимальную скорость, с которой данные могут быть переданы по определенному каналу связи. При этом входящие и исходящие потоки информации отличаются по показателям. Стандарт для измерения пропускной способности - битрейт (бит/с). В инете тоже пустые тексты

      @unicoxr5tj417@unicoxr5tj41716 күн бұрын
KZhead